Project Director

CORE is looking for a Project Director to oversee a staff of Construction Project Managers and Superintendents managing large scale commercial construction projects throughout California. The Project Director will oversee multiple large-scale preconstruction and construction phase projects and contribute to client service and business development.

Responsibilities

Oversee a staff of Construction Project Managers and Superintendents managing large scale commercial construction projects throughout California
Oversee multiple large-scale preconstruction and construction phase projects and staff members for a wide range of institutional clients, including colleges, universities, K-12 districts, municipalities, healthcare systems and more
Serve all existing clients’ needs as it pertains to their projects in preconstruction, construction and warranty
Maintain staffing levels on CORE’s projects, and lead all training/mentoring of our project teams and field staff
Contribute to client service and business development, helping to ensure our company for future work with new and existing clients
Attend events and outings with clients, architects and trade partners to help build and maintain relationships

Required

Minimum of 10 years of experience as a construction project manager, and specific experience managing commercial construction
Detailed understanding of construction project sequencing and scheduling
Advanced understanding of drawings and specifications as well as constructability
Ability to negotiate, write and execute all subcontract agreements
Willingness to relocate to or near the Sacramento area
Strong communications skills, both written and verbal
Technology: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Excel & Outlook), MS Project and Procore
Experience with CMAR and/or Design/Build delivery methods
Must work well in a team environment and be committed to client service
A valid Driver's License

Preferred

Professional Degree in construction management, architecture or a related field (mechanical or civil engineering, construction tech, interior design, business administration)

CORE is a Construction Manager-at-Risk, Design-Build, General Contracting, Program Management, and Job Order Contractor with over 1,200 employees providing annual revenue in excess of $1.5 billion.
